1944Paula Danziger, American author (died 2004)[†]

Paula Danziger was an American children's author who wrote more than 30 books, including her 1974 debut The Cat Ate My Gymsuit, for children's and young adult audiences. At the time of her death, all her books were still in print; they had been published in 53 countries and translated into 14 languages.

1944Robert Hitchcock, Australian sculptor and illustrator[†]

Robert Charles Hitchcock is an Australian sculptor. He commenced his career in 1970 and works in a wide variety of subjects and materials. Hitchcock is one of the leading portrait sculptors currently working in Australia today. He is known for his life size bronze sculptures which are located in private collections as well as public works of art in Australia and overseas.

1944Ernst Thälmann, German soldier and politician (born 1886)[†]

Ernst Johannes Fritz Thälmann was a German communist politician and leader of the Communist Party of Germany (KPD) from 1925 to 1933.
